The Sexological World, Trauma, and Couples
from The Cultured Therapist · host R.C. Winters
In this episode of 'The Cultured Therapist,' we explore the intersection of mental health and the arts with Louisiana-based counselor Kate Lemoine. With a background in fine arts and massage therapy, Kate shares how her diverse experiences have informed her approach to clinical mental health counseling. The discussion delves into how somatic memories can influence current emotions and relationships, emphasizing the importance of authenticity and human experience in therapy. What this episode covers
Kate Lemoine, a licensed counselor in Louisiana discusses the controversy around individual sessions in couples work, the foundational power of the sexual in relationship work, and her journey to her peak of professional training and joy in her work.
